[发明专利]一种实现图片拼接的装置、方法和图片处理系统有效
申请号: | 201510549152.1 | 申请日: | 2012-11-12 |
公开(公告)号: | CN105046678B | 公开(公告)日: | 2018-05-18 |
发明(设计)人: | 刘文剑;叶特峰 | 申请(专利权)人: | 北京奇虎科技有限公司;奇智软件(北京)有限公司 |
主分类号: | G06T5/50 | 分类号: | G06T5/50;G06T3/40 |
代理公司: | 北京市隆安律师事务所 11323 | 代理人: | 权鲜枝;何立春 |
地址: | 100088 北京市西城区新*** | 国省代码: | 北京;11 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 实现 图片 拼接 装置 方法 处理 系统 | ||
1.一种实现图片拼接的装置,包括模板库单元、图片提取单元、匹配单元和拼图单元,其中:
所述模板库单元,适于保存多种拼图模板;
所述图片提取单元,适于从图片源中提取指定个数的图片并保存,对所保存的各图片按照尺寸以及横图和/或竖图进行分类,得到每种尺寸的横图的个数和/或每种尺寸的竖图的个数,并通知所述匹配单元;
所述匹配单元,适于在收到所述图片提取单元通知的每种尺寸的横图的个数和/或每种尺寸的竖图的个数时,从所述模板库单元中查找对应尺寸的横图框个数大于或等于图片提取单元通知的对应尺寸的横图个数,和/或对应尺寸的竖图框个数大于或等于获取单元通知的对应尺寸的竖图个数的拼图模板;以及
所述拼图单元,适于将所述图片提取单元中保存的各图片按类型套用到匹配单元所通知的拼图模板中的各图框内,生成拼接后的图片。
2.如权利要求1所述的实现图片拼接的装置,其中,
所述匹配单元,适于在没有查找到匹配的拼图模板时,向所述图片提取单元发送通知;
所述图片提取单元还适于:在收到所述匹配单元的通知时,从所保存的图片中删除预定个数的图片,或从图片源中再获取预定个数的图片进行保存,然后对所保存的图片按照尺寸以及横图和/或竖图重新进行分类,将分类结果通知所述匹配单元。
3.如权利要求1所述的实现图片拼接的装置,其中,所述图片源为本地图片源或服务器端的图片数据库;
所述图片提取单元,适于从本地图片源中或者服务器端的图片数据库中提取指定个数的图片并保存。
4.如权利要求1-3中任一项所述的实现图片拼接的装置,其中,所述图片源为本地图片源或服务器端的图片数据库;
所述图片提取单元还适于:从本地图片源中或者服务器端的图片数据库中按指定顺序和/或随机提取指定个数的图片并保存。
5.一种实现图片拼接的方法,包括:
从图片源中提取指定个数的图片;
对已获取的各图片按照尺寸以及横图和/或竖图进行分类,得到每种尺寸的横图的个数和/或每种尺寸的竖图的个数;
从模板库中查找,对应尺寸的横图框个数大于或等于已获取图片中的对应尺寸的横图个数,和/或对应尺寸的竖图框个数大于或等于已获取图片中的对应尺寸的竖图个数的拼图模板;
如果查找到一个以上的匹配的拼图模板,则从所述一个以上的匹配的拼图模板中,选择一个拼图模板,将已获取的各图片按类型套用到所选择的拼图模板中的各图框内,生成拼接后的图片。
6.如权利要求5所述的实现图片拼接的方法,进一步包括:
如果没有查找到匹配的拼图模板,则从已获取的图片中删除预定个数的图片,或从图片源中再获取预定个数的图片增加到已获取的图片中,返回所述对已获取的各图片进行分类的步骤。
7.如权利要求5所述的实现图片拼接的方法,其中,
所述图片源为本地图片源;
或者,
所述图片源为服务器端的图片数据库。
8.如权利要求5所述的实现图片拼接的方法,其中,
所述从图片源中提取指定个数的图片包括:从图片源中按指定顺序和/或随机提取指定个数的图片。
9.如权利要求5至8中任一项所述的实现图片拼接的方法,其中,该方法进一步包括:
重复所述从图片源中提取指定个数的图片至所述生成拼接后的图片的步骤,生成多个拼接后的图片,并按指定顺序播放所述多个拼接后的图片。
10.一种图片处理系统,包括:一个或多个如权利要求1-4中任一项所述的实现图片拼接的装置,以及一个或多个图片源,其中,
所述图片源中的一个或多个为本地图片源或服务器端的图片数据库。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于北京奇虎科技有限公司;奇智软件(北京)有限公司,未经北京奇虎科技有限公司;奇智软件(北京)有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201510549152.1/1.html,转载请声明来源钻瓜专利网。